협조적 게임이론을 이용한 국가 간 수산자원관리에 관한 연구
최종두,조정희 한국해양과학기술원 2008 Ocean and Polar Research Vol.30 No.2
This study demonstrates that cooperative management can provide more benefits than non-cooperative management for Korea and Japan fishery. We have studied one management strategy, namely, fishing under joint maximization of net benefits in coastal waters of two countries, using a cooperative game theory. The present net return under non-cooperation amounts to 420,255 million won. However, if two countries cooperate one with another, this figure can get to 2,636,565 million won. We consider this to be an important conclusion as close management relationships have developed between the two countries since the establishment of the EEZ in 1996. The results of the study can also help balance resource conservation and the appropriate catch quota in each country.
기후변화로 인한 수온상승이 굴양식 본양성 생산방식의 경제성에 미치는 영향분석
최종두,최영준 한국해양과학기술원 2014 Ocean and Polar Research Vol.36 No.2
This study analysed the economic feasibility per hectare of grow out phase production of Oyster farming by rising water temperature in Ocean. Elevated Water temperature by climate change had a bad influence for oyster production and economic feasibility. In the case of production units, the total output of oyster decreases from 213,840 to 205,594 units. Using cost-benefit analysis with discounting rates (5.5%), we estimated the net present value (NPV) and benefit cost ratio (BCR) until 2100 years. The model results showed that the NPV without water temperature rise was 1,565,619,893 won and the NPV with water temperature rise was 1,540,493,059 won. Also, BCR estimated that the former was 2.095 better than the latter was 2.077. To summarise, the economic effect per hectare of water temperature rise in ocean did the damage to the economic loss about 25,126,834 won.
